Trains from Bodegraven to Ede run on average 25 times per day, taking around 50m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at $40 (€33) if you book in advance.

The earliest train runs at 00:16, the last at 23:16. The fastest train covers the 38 miles (62 km) distance in 45m.

To explore Ede and its surroundings, a visit of 2 to 3 days is typically sufficient to experience its main attractions, such as the Hoge Veluwe National Park, Kröller-Müller Museum, and local cultural activities.

Since both Bodegraven and Ede are in the Schengen Area, a passport is not required for European Union (EU) or Schengen-associated country citizens. A national ID card is sufficient.

The currency used in the Netherlands is the Euro (EUR). Travelers generally find it more convenient to use cards, as most places accept debit and credit cards, though having some cash on hand is useful for small purchases or in rural areas.
In Ede, travelers should be aware of pickpocketing in crowded areas and public transportation. Bicycle theft is also common, so securing bikes properly is important. Scams are rare but travelers should remain cautious when approached by strangers offering unsolicited help or deals. Overall, standard urban safety precautions apply.
